diff --git a/docs/docsite/rst/shared_snippets/installing_multiple_collections.txt b/docs/docsite/rst/shared_snippets/installing_multiple_collections.txt new file mode 100644 index 0000000..a1b18b5 --- /dev/null +++ b/docs/docsite/rst/shared_snippets/installing_multiple_collections.txt @@ -0,0 +1,77 @@ + +You can set up a ``requirements.yml`` file to install multiple collections in one command. This file is a YAML file in the format: + +.. code-block:: yaml+jinja + + --- + collections: + # With just the collection name + - my_namespace.my_collection + + # With the collection name, version, and source options + - name: my_namespace.my_other_collection + version: ">=1.2.0" # Version range identifiers (default: ``*``) + source: ... # The Galaxy URL to pull the collection from (default: ``--api-server`` from cmdline) + +You can specify the following keys for each collection entry: + + * ``name`` + * ``version`` + * ``signatures`` + * ``source`` + * ``type`` + +The ``version`` key uses the same range identifier format documented in :ref:`collections_older_version`. + +The ``signatures`` key accepts a list of signature sources that are used to supplement those found on the Galaxy server during collection installation and ``ansible-galaxy collection verify``. Signature sources should be URIs that contain the detached signature. The ``--keyring`` CLI option must be provided if signatures are specified. + +Signatures are only used to verify collections on Galaxy servers. User-provided signatures are not used to verify collections installed from git repositories, source directories, or URLs/paths to tar.gz files. + +.. code-block:: yaml + + collections: + - name: namespace.name + version: 1.0.0 + type: galaxy + signatures: + - https://examplehost.com/detached_signature.asc + - file:///path/to/local/detached_signature.asc + +The ``type`` key can be set to ``file``, ``galaxy``, ``git``, ``url``, ``dir``, or ``subdirs``. If ``type`` is omitted, the ``name`` key is used to implicitly determine the source of the collection. + +When you install a collection with ``type: git``, the ``version`` key can refer to a branch or to a `git commit-ish <https://git-scm.com/docs/gitglossary#def_commit-ish>`_ object (commit or tag). For example: + +.. code-block:: yaml + + collections: + - name: https://github.com/organization/repo_name.git + type: git + version: devel + +You can also add roles to a ``requirements.yml`` file, under the ``roles`` key. The values follow the same format as a requirements file used in older Ansible releases. + +.. code-block:: yaml + + --- + roles: + # Install a role from Ansible Galaxy. + - name: geerlingguy.java + version: "1.9.6" # note that ranges are not supported for roles + + + collections: + # Install a collection from Ansible Galaxy. + - name: geerlingguy.php_roles + version: ">=0.9.3" + source: https://galaxy.ansible.com + +To install both roles and collections at the same time with one command, run the following: + +.. code-block:: bash + + $ ansible-galaxy install -r requirements.yml + +Running ``ansible-galaxy collection install -r`` or ``ansible-galaxy role install -r`` will only install collections, or roles respectively. + +.. note:: + Installing both roles and collections from the same requirements file will not work when specifying a custom collection or role install path. In this scenario the collections will be skipped and the command will process each like ``ansible-galaxy role install`` would. |
